    i have a 2001 dodge 1500 5 speed manual the tail shaft sounds like grinding in 1, 2 , 3 and 5 gears not in 4 as bad can i leave tranny in truck and pull the tail shaft and anyone know what could be wrong with itdoes

    I have done uni joints on different cars and I can`t see your truck being different.


    The tail shaft is held to the front of the differential housing by 4 studs . Remove these and the tail shaft can be pushed a little forward into the gear box and then drop back end of shaft down and pull out of box.


    The uni joints are held by circlips that have to be removed to take old uni out.


    Suggest both front and rear unis replaced whilst you have tail shaft out.
